How Can I Find a Depression Support Group in Hartford County?
Support groups in Hartford County meet regularly at community centers, hospitals, and mental health facilities. Local organizations like Hartford Hospital and the Institute of Living offer weekly group sessions. These meetings provide a safe space to connect with others facing similar challenges. Many groups are free to attend and don’t require insurance coverage or prior registration. You can find current meeting schedules by calling 866-629-4564 or checking local mental health center websites.
Depression support groups offer many advantages for mental health recovery. Members share their experiences, coping strategies, and success stories in a judgment-free setting. Regular attendance helps reduce feelings of isolation and builds a strong support network. Group members often learn new ways to manage symptoms through others’ experiences. The structured environment provides accountability and routine, which are helpful tools in depression management.
Most depression support groups in Hartford County welcome new members without requiring professional referrals. Open groups allow anyone to join at any time, while some closed groups may need basic registration. Local organizations running these groups focus on making them accessible to everyone needing support. Many groups encourage you to simply show up at meeting times, though calling ahead can help you learn about group guidelines and meeting details.
Many depression support groups in Hartford County are free of charge. Local hospitals, mental health centers, and community organizations often provide these services at no cost to participants. Some specialized groups might have minimal fees, but financial assistance is usually available. Groups typically focus on maintaining accessibility for all community members, regardless of their financial situation.

Depression support groups in Hartford County typically meet weekly or bi-weekly. Meeting schedules vary by location and group type, with some offering multiple session times to accommodate different schedules. Many groups maintain regular meeting times to help members establish routine attendance. Some organizations also offer additional monthly workshops or special topic sessions for group members.
Hartford County residents can access both in-person and online support groups. Virtual meetings became more common and continue to serve those who prefer remote participation. Online groups use secure platforms and follow similar formats to in-person meetings. These virtual options provide flexibility for those with transportation issues or scheduling conflicts while maintaining the benefits of group support.
Hartford County offers various specialized support groups targeting different needs. Some groups focus on specific age ranges, like youth or seniors. Others address particular experiences such as postpartum depression or grief-related depression. General depression support groups welcome anyone experiencing depressive symptoms. Some groups also accommodate both individuals with depression and their family members.
Support groups are typically led by mental health professionals, trained facilitators, or peer leaders with personal recovery experience. Many group leaders have specific training in group facilitation and mental health support. Some groups use a co-leader model, combining professional guidance with peer support. Leaders help maintain group structure, ensure productive discussions, and provide resources when needed.
Finding the right depression support group involves considering several factors. Look for groups that fit your schedule and location preferences. Consider whether you’d prefer a general or specialized group format. You can call group organizers to ask about their approach and typical meeting structure. Many groups allow you to observe a session before committing, helping you find the best match for your needs.
